Batty Pass Caves have an interesting backstory. They are three shallow, man-made caves that were carved out by brothers who ran a small mining business out of them in the 1950s. The path to these caves is open to vehicles but can often be hard to reach without a 4-wheel drive vehicle. If your vehicle can make it, there is an area that allows parking next to the caves.

Moqui Cave is a natural history museum within a cave off Highway 89. The museum displays and informs about Native American artifacts, rocks and minerals from around the world, and information about The Church of Ladder-Day Saints.

These man-made caves are a part of an old sand mine used to harvest sand for glass making. This trail can be difficult for some hikers because it begins with ascending (and then eventually descending on the way back) a steep, slick rock. This is a very popular area to explore, due to its proximity to the highway. Hikers can expect to see dozens of other people on this short trail.

The Moqui Cave has a rich history, having been used by Anasazi people as a shelter and later as a speakeasy. Today, it houses extensive collections of Native American artifacts and dinosaur tracks. The Batty Pass Caves are also historically interesting, as they are shallow, man-made caves carved out by brothers who ran a small mining business in the 1950s.
The Kanab Sand Caves (Moqui Caverns) are a series of man-made caves carved into Navajo Sandstone. They were created in the 1970s for silica sand mining. Their unique smooth, wave-like formations and the interplay of light and shadow create a visually stunning environment, making them a popular spot for exploration and photography.
The hike to the Kanab Sand Caves is considered easy and relatively short, about 1.2 miles round trip. However, it does involve a semi-steep climb up slick rock, so shoes with good traction are recommended. Due to its popularity and proximity to the highway, you can expect to see many other visitors on this trail.
Moqui Cave is a natural history museum. Inside, you'll find Native American artifacts, including over 1,000 arrowheads, pottery, and tools. It also features paleontological exhibits with over 180 dinosaur tracks and one of the largest fluorescent mineral displays in the United States, where rocks glow under ultraviolet light. The cave maintains a cool temperature, never rising above 65 degrees Fahrenheit.
No, the Belly of the Dragon Tunnel is a man-made tunnel located under Highway 89. It was originally constructed as a drainage culvert, but its winding, ribbed interior and unique rock formations, shaped by wind and water erosion, have made it a popular and photogenic roadside attraction that offers a cave-like exploratory experience.

For caves like the Kanab Sand Caves, good traction shoes are essential due to steep, slick rock climbs. For any cave exploration, comfortable clothing that allows for movement is advisable. Bringing a flashlight or using your phone's light is recommended for darker areas like the Belly of the Dragon Tunnel.
Yes, the path to the Batty Pass Caves is open to vehicles, but it can often be hard to reach without a 4-wheel drive vehicle. If your vehicle can make it, there is an area that allows parking next to the caves.
The caves in Kane County are primarily carved into Navajo Sandstone, showcasing unique formations. For instance, the Kanab Sand Caves feature smooth, wave-like formations. Moqui Cave also houses extensive geological exhibits, including dinosaur tracks and a fluorescent mineral display, highlighting the region's rich geological history.
